Essential Metrics to Track Across Platforms

Not all metrics deserve equal attention. Effective social media insights techniques focus on indicators that connect to business goals. Here’s what matters most:

Engagement Metrics

  • Engagement Rate: Total interactions divided by reach or followers. This shows content resonance regardless of audience size.
  • Comments and Replies: Direct audience responses indicate strong interest and conversation potential.
  • Shares and Saves: These actions suggest content value beyond passive consumption.

Reach and Awareness Metrics

  • Impressions: Total times content appears on screens. Useful for brand visibility tracking.
  • Reach: Unique users who see your content. More accurate than impressions for audience size assessment.
  • Follower Growth Rate: Speed of audience expansion. Sudden spikes or drops signal content or campaign impact.

Conversion Metrics

  • Click-Through Rate (CTR): Percentage of viewers who click links. Critical for driving traffic.
  • Conversion Rate: Visitors who complete desired actions after arriving from social channels.
  • Cost Per Click (CPC): Paid campaign efficiency measure.

Each platform offers native analytics dashboards. Facebook Insights, Instagram Insights, LinkedIn Analytics, and X (Twitter) Analytics provide these metrics directly. Third-party tools consolidate data across platforms for easier comparison.

Top Techniques for Gathering Social Media Insights

Collecting data requires both tools and methods. These social media insights techniques form a solid foundation for any analysis strategy.

Native Platform Analytics

Start with built-in tools. They’re free, accurate, and updated in real time. Instagram’s Professional Dashboard shows content performance by type. LinkedIn’s analytics break down visitor demographics. Facebook provides detailed post reach and engagement timelines.

Check these dashboards weekly at minimum. Monthly reviews miss short-term trends that could inform quick adjustments.

Social Listening Tools

Brand mentions happen beyond your own profiles. Social listening tracks conversations about your brand, products, industry, and competitors across the entire social web. Tools like Sprout Social, Hootsuite, and Brandwatch capture this broader picture.

Sentiment analysis, understanding whether mentions are positive, negative, or neutral, adds emotional context to raw volume data.

A/B Testing

Test one variable at a time: headlines, images, posting times, or call-to-action phrases. Compare performance between versions. This scientific approach removes opinion from decision-making and lets data guide content choices.

Audience Surveys and Polls

Platform-native polls (Instagram Stories, X, LinkedIn) gather direct feedback quickly. Ask followers about content preferences, product interests, or service experiences. Response rates typically exceed email surveys because participation requires minimal effort.

UTM Tracking

Add UTM parameters to links shared on social platforms. Google Analytics then tracks exactly which posts, platforms, and campaigns drive website traffic and conversions. This technique connects social activity to bottom-line results.

Turning Raw Data Into Actionable Strategies

Data collection means nothing without interpretation and action. These steps transform numbers into decisions.

Identify Patterns and Trends

Look for recurring themes in high-performing content. Do videos consistently outperform images? Does educational content generate more saves than promotional posts? Weekly and monthly comparisons reveal seasonal patterns and long-term shifts.

Set Benchmarks and Goals

Establish baseline metrics before launching new strategies. Without a starting point, progress becomes impossible to measure. Industry benchmarks provide external reference points, but internal trends matter more for tracking improvement.

Create Regular Reporting Cadences

Weekly snapshots catch quick wins and emerging problems. Monthly reports track broader trends. Quarterly reviews assess strategy effectiveness and inform larger pivots. Consistency matters more than complexity, simple reports reviewed regularly beat detailed analyses that gather dust.

Test, Learn, and Iterate

Social media insights techniques work best in cycles. Analyze data, form hypotheses, test changes, measure results, and repeat. This continuous improvement loop builds knowledge over time and prevents strategy stagnation.

Communicate Findings to Stakeholders

Translate data into business language for leadership. Focus on metrics that connect to revenue, cost savings, or strategic goals. Visual dashboards and clear summaries make insights accessible to non-specialists who influence budgets and priorities.
